Hello all - My involvement with Passwordsafe has been minimal to say the least. My only contribution was to suggest a safer alternative to the original secure string class, way back when the project first appeared on SourceForge. I don't know if the changes were ever made (I never touched the code), but in my posts to the mailing list I mentioned an article I wrote on secure STL containers. I just wanted to let everyone know that article has been published (finally!) in the May 2003 issue of C/C++ User's Journal. The latest source code is available for download at http://www.eddeye.net/src/secalloc.html The included documentation and examples are enough to figure out how to use it, but I would recommend reading the article to learn about the gotchas and determine if it's suitable for use in PasswordSafe.
